Also, cool clam. Whats their light requirments?
 
Gboy66 said:
Very cool man!! How'd you get them for free!?

Also, cool clam. Whats their light requirments?

Clams require high light and very good water quality. That is why I waited for 8 months to get one. The tank should be well established.
